23:01, 23 November 2006

Azerbaijani police violently dispersed protesters against pressure on mass media

Today in Baku, capital of Azerbaijan, the police have again violently dispersed a picket of activists of the Party of National Front of Azerbaijan (PNFA). The action was held with the demand to stop pressure on the freedom of speech.

Policemen began detaining people who gathered in small groups in the mini-park near the President's Administration and putting them into buses well before the start of the action.

However, despite these measures, a group of some 30 persons decided to break through to the building, however police began to beat them severely with their truncheons. Police have hardly cleared the mini-park of the oppositionists, when a group of women - about 15 persons - appeared and made their way to the administrations of the president. Policemen blocked their way and hustled the women inside the subway station. Many participants of the action were detained by police and brought to police stations. Among those arrested were journalists, in particular, Seimur Khasiev, editor of the "Bizim Yol" newspaper.

Author: Zaur Rasulzade, CK correspondent

The illustration was created by the Caucasian Knot using AI The peace agreement between Armenia and Azerbaijan, as well as other documents signed at the meeting with Trump on August 8, 2025

The “Caucasian Knot" publishes the agreement on the establishment of peace and interstate relations between Azerbaijan and Armenia, which was initialed by Armenian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an and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ev on August 8, 2025, through the mediation of US President Donald Trump. The meeting of Trump, Aliyev and Pashinyan took place on August 8 in Washington. Following the meeting, Pashinyan and Aliyev also signed a joint declaration. In addition to the agreements between Armenia and Azerbaijan, Trump signed a number of separate memoranda with Aliyev and Pashinyan....
